[发明专利]网页数据解析方法、装置及计算机可读存储介质在审
申请号: | 201910042023.1 | 申请日: | 2019-01-17 |
公开(公告)号: | CN109918428A | 公开(公告)日: | 2019-06-21 |
发明(设计)人: | 檀传华;冉梦龙;孟文斌;李祖光;陈锦韬 | 申请(专利权)人: | 重庆金融资产交易所有限责任公司 |
主分类号: | G06F16/25 | 分类号: | G06F16/25;G06F16/951 |
代理公司: | 深圳市沃德知识产权代理事务所(普通合伙) 44347 | 代理人: | 高杰;于志光 |
地址: | 400010 重庆市渝*** | 国省代码: | 重庆;50 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 抓取 网页数据解析 解析 数据抓取 计算机可读存储介质 页面 网页抓取 页面数据 结构化数据格式 数据采集技术 结构化数据 结构化信息 独立运行 分开执行 格式转换 网络页面 网站结构 数据处理 低耦合 内聚 匹配 抽取 存储 转换 | ||
1.一种网页数据解析方法,其特征在于,所述方法包括:
在进行数据抓取时,针对需抓取的数据所在的网络页面,解析并获取待抓取数据所在的页面个数;
根据解析出的待抓取数据所在的页面个数,利用与所述页面个数相匹配的数据抓取方式进行数据抓取,得到抓取的页面数据;
针对抓取到的所述页面数据进行数据处理,生成所需的结构化数据并存储。
2.如权利要求1所述的网页数据解析方法,其特征在于,所述根据解析出的待抓取数据所在的页面个数,利用与所述页面个数相匹配的数据抓取方式进行数据抓取,得到抓取的页面数据,包括:
若待抓取数据在单个页面中,则从所述单个页面中提取对应的HTML文件片段;
若待抓取数据在多个页面中,则从所述待抓取数据对应的多个页面中提取对应的页面数据,并根据所述多个页面间的数据关系,将提取的页面数据生成对应的数组。
3.如权利要求2所述的网页数据解析方法,其特征在于,所述根据所述多个页面间的数据关系,将提取的页面数据生成对应的数组,包括:
根据待抓取数据对应的网络页面HTML结构中的表标签,提取所述网络页面HTML结构中的页面数据,生成包含表的标题和所述标题对应的明细数据的二维数组。
4.如权利要求1所述的网页数据解析方法,其特征在于,所述针对抓取到的所述页面数据进行数据处理,生成所需的结构化数据并存储,包括:
从抓取到的所述页面数据中抽取出结构化数据,得到抽取后余下的非结构化数据;
针对非结构化数据,利用数据加工引擎,按照预设的配置文件,对所述非机构数据进行格式转换,生成所需的结构化数据;
将抽取出的所述结构化数据与生成的所述结构化数据均保存至分布式存储型数据库中。
5.如权利要求1至4任一项所述的网页数据解析方法,其特征在于,所述针对抓取到的所述页面数据进行数据处理,生成所需的结构化数据并存储,之前还包括步骤:
对抓取到的所述页面数据进行数据清洗。
6.一种网页数据解析装置,其特征在于,所述装置包括存储器和处理器,所述存储器上存储有可在所述处理器上运行的网页数据解析程序,所述网页数据解析程序被所述处理器执行时实现如下步骤:
在进行数据抓取时,针对需抓取的数据所在的网络页面,解析并获取待抓取数据所在的页面个数;
根据解析出的待抓取数据所在的页面个数,利用与所述页面个数相匹配的数据抓取方式进行数据抓取,得到抓取的页面数据;
针对抓取到的所述页面数据进行数据处理,生成所需的结构化数据并存储。
7.如权利要求6所述的网页数据解析装置,其特征在于,所述网页数据解析程序还可被所述处理器执行,以在根据解析出的待抓取数据所在的页面个数,利用与所述页面个数相匹配的数据抓取方式进行数据抓取,得到抓取的页面数据,包括:
若待抓取数据在单个页面中,则从所述单个页面中提取对应的HTML文件片段;
若待抓取数据在多个页面中,则从所述待抓取数据对应的多个页面中提取对应的页面数据,并根据所述多个页面间的数据关系,将提取的页面数据生成对应的数组。
8.如权利要求7所述的网页数据解析装置,其特征在于,所述网页数据解析程序还可被所述处理器执行,以在所述根据所述多个页面间的数据关系,将提取的页面数据生成对应的数组,包括:
根据待抓取数据对应的网络页面HTML结构中的表标签,提取所述网络页面HTML结构中的页面数据,生成包含表的标题和所述标题对应的明细数据的二维数组。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于重庆金融资产交易所有限责任公司,未经重庆金融资产交易所有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910042023.1/1.html,转载请声明来源钻瓜专利网。